In a motor vehicle lease, it is essential to provide a mathematical progression showing how the periodic payment is derived, which includes the gross capitalized cost (the agreed-on value of the vehicle), the rent charge (the difference between the total of base payments over the lease term minus the depreciation and any amortized amounts), and an itemization of other charges that are part of the periodic payment.
